Program Overview

The course teaches concepts, approaches, techniques and tools for use within projects to achieve goals, deliver services, and meet targeted objectives. Participants will develop a basic understanding of the fundamentals of Project Management in the areas of: Project Planning Concepts, Work Breakdown Structures, Activity Network, Schedule Development, Risk Management, Communications Management, Project Delivery and Control and Closing a project

Students will have the opportunity to roll up their sleeves and participate in a hands-on, computer based projectmanagement training simulation. In this experiential learning activity students apply what they learned in a thoroughly engaging exercise. The system provides immediate feedback and an insightful critique for each decision the team makes. Every participant leaves the training with enhanced project management skills which will  improve their job performance the minute they return to their workplace.
